Quick answer
1 kilogray = 1e+6 milligray.
Formula
milligray = kilogray × 1e+6

About these units
kilogray is a unit used in radiation absorbed dose conversions. Absorbed dose measures energy deposited by ionizing radiation per unit mass. Its recorded symbol is kGy. milligray is a unit used in radiation absorbed dose conversions. Absorbed dose measures energy deposited by ionizing radiation per unit mass. Its recorded symbol is mGy.
